Katy's first album, Katy Hudson (2001), was a gospel release. She later adopted her mother's maiden name to lessen confusion with actress Kate Hudson. Now singing as Katy Perry, she released Ur So Gay in 2007, spurring criticism of it for homophobia, though such is far from clear-cut. Perry claims the song is about her excessively emo ex-boyfriend.[2] A second single in a similar vein, I Kissed a Girl climbed to #1 on the Billboard 100, June 2008, and she has been a consistent presence in pop music ever since.
